Restaurant Summary
Tucked in an industrial stretch near the airport, Sparky’s feels low-key and welcoming with counter ordering and generous plates hitting the tables in takeout boxes. Diners call out super friendly service on good nights and praise a spotless room. One traveler summed it up: "We skipped resort dining and got bold flavors that felt crafted with care." The cooking leans Hawaiian comfort first—katsu, mochiko chicken, loco moco—amped by signature Hurricane sauces, guava and spicy pineapple glazes, fresh mahi, and market-price poke. It is not fussy, just satisfying and bold, better for flavor chasers than minimalists. Expect some variability during rushes, but when it hits, the crispy textures and saucy richness make sense of the buzz. Families do well here thanks to familiar kid options (burgers, chicken, fries) and mini sizes. The menu’s Hawaiian plates and sauced chicken might be intense for picky eaters, but plain sides, simple seafood, and reported kids meals help. Plan a buffer if arriving with little ones during peak hours.

What to Order
- If spice-averse, choose mellow Hurricane instead of spicy; staff can guide sauce choice.
- For lighter dining, choose mini plates ($13-15) plus green salad ($3).
- Seafood fans: Mahi Piccata ($23) or Kumu's Shrimp ($25-26) offer non-fried options.
